About Jim Kirk
Jim comes to Info-Tech having led IT service and project delivery in the public sector for over 20 years. His leadership career began in the Ontario Public Service, where he played a leadership role in service desk consolidation and modernization efforts and the implementation of ITIL best practices. A move back home to the East Coast and into municipal government with the Halifax Regional Municipality saw his scope broaden, providing the opportunity to engage across the service lifecycle. While there, he implemented a business relationship management function, led significant improvement in the ERP space, and led early program development around Smart City initiatives. He then transitioned to the higher education sector as the Technology Leader for Nova Scotia Community College. During his time at the college, he led the implementation of its five-year technology strategy and helped the institution pivot its program delivery online during the COVID-19 pandemic.
Jim is passionate about building high-performing teams that deliver sustainable services through the implementation of best practices. He focuses on the customer in everything he does and strongly believes in using performance measurement to drive continuous improvement.
